Iodinated contrast is a form of water-soluble, intravenous radiocontrast agent containing iodine, which enhances the visibility of vascular structures and organs during radiographic procedures. Some pathologies, such as cancer , have particularly improved visibility with iodinated contrast.
Iodinated contrast contains iodine.It is the main type of radiocontrast used for intravenous administration.Iodine has a particular advantage as a contrast agent for radiography because its innermost electron ("k-shell") binding energy is 33.2 keV, similar to the average energy of x-rays used in diagnostic radiography.
For radiography, which is based on X-rays, iodine and barium are the most common types of contrast agent. Various sorts of iodinated contrast agents exist, with variations occurring between the osmolarity, viscosity and absolute iodine content.
Iohexol, sold under the trade name Omnipaque among others, is a contrast agent used for X-ray imaging. Contrast CT, or contrast-enhanced computed tomography (CECT), is X-ray computed tomography (CT) using radiocontrast. Radiocontrasts for X-ray CT are generally iodine-based types . Diatrizoate, also known as amidotrizoate, Gastrografin, is a contrast agent used during X-ray imaging. Ioxaglic acid is an iodine-containing, water-soluble radiocontrast agent. The iodine atoms readily absorb X-rays, resulting in a higher contrast of X-ray images.
